Transform Your Yard: Affordable Curb Appeal Ideas
Enhance your home's first impression without destroying the bank with these easy and creative curb appeal upgrades. A fresh coat of paint on your front door can accentuate the entire facade, while adding some potted flowers or vibrant annuals instantly adds a touch of welcome.
Consider installing some outdoor lighting to emphasize architectural features and create a warm and inviting feeling in the evening. Even simple touches like a new mailbox, house numbers, or a welcoming doormat can make a big variation.
With a little imagination, you can easily transform your yard into a eye-catcher on any budget.
